Story Overview of Treasure Planet
When space galleon cabin boy Jim Hawkins discovers a map to an intergalactic "loot of a thousand worlds," a cyborg cook named John Silver teaches him to battle supernovas and space storms on their journey to find treasure.

Treasure Planet Details and Cast
| Movie Name | Treasure Planet |
| Original Language | En |
| Spoken Language | English |
| Release Date | 2002-11-26 |
| Runtime | 96 minutes |
| Country | United States of America |
| Genres | Science Fiction, Adventure, Animation, Family, Fantasy |
| Writer | N/A |
| Director | John Musker, Ron Clements |
| Producer | Ron Clements, Roy Conli, John Musker |

Treasure Planet Star Cast
| Joseph Gordon-Levitt | Jim Hawkins (voice) |
| Brian Murray | John Silver (voice) |
| Emma Thompson | Captain Amelia (voice) |
| David Hyde Pierce | Doctor Doppler (voice) |
| Martin Short | B.E.N. (voice) |
| Dane A. Davis | Morph (voice) |
| Michael Wincott | Scroop (voice) |
| Laurie Metcalf | Sarah (voice) |
| Roscoe Lee Browne | Mr. Arrow (voice) |
| Patrick McGoohan | Billy Bones (voice) |
